Quinton Hanson
Quinton Hanson was a Republican candidate for District 1 of the Alabama House of Representatives. The primary election was on June 1, 2010, and the general election was on November 2.
Hanson was a candidate for the Alabama State Senate in 2002.
Hanson has worked as a Private Pilot for Angel Flight. He then worked as organizer for Underwood Petersville Fire Department. He founded Associated Insurors, Inc. in 1991 and has worked there since.
Hanson and his wife, Susan, have two children.
Elections
2010
Hanson defeated Brad Holmes in the June 1 primary. He was then defeated by Greg Burdine in the November 2 general election.[1][2]
